Gate.io Conducts 54th Contract Points Airdrop with NIBI Tokens

Gate.io’s 54th Contract Points Airdrop awarded over $27 per account through NIBI tokens, requiring ≥120 points for 3000 NIBI or ≥40 points for a 100 USDT trial voucher, with a cost of 15 or 20 points respectively.

Gate.io organized its 54th Contract Points Airdrop, distributing NIBI tokens. Users with over 120 Contract Points received 3000 NIBI tokens. The value per account exceeded $27 at peak, impacting eligible cryptocurrency holders.

The event focused on enhancing Gate.io’s futures trading rewards. Gate.io continues to offer incentives through these airdrops, with no broader market disruptions reported. The airdrop strategy targets increased user engagement on the platform.

Examining past events, Gate.io’s airdrops consistently offer tiered rewards, using strategies to engage and retain users. This 54th event had limited influence on external token markets. The incentives align with Gate.io’s efforts to expand its user base.

The absence of official announcements or key opinion leader commentary limited detailed insights about the event. However, data from on-chain activities helped outline the financial implications. NIBI reached $0.009086 and a market cap of approximately $1.6 million.

Photographer: Daniel Heuer/Bloomberg via Getty Images Daniel Heuer | Bloomberg | Getty Images Newly-confirmed Federal Reserve Governor Stephen Miran dissented from the central bank’s decision to lower the federal funds rate by a quarter percentage point on Wednesday, choosing instead to call for a half-point cut. Miran, who was confirmed by the Senate to the Fed Board of Governors on Monday, was the sole dissenter in the Federal Open Market Committee’s statement. Governors Michelle Bowman and Christopher Waller, who had dissented at the Fed’s prior meeting in favor of a quarter-point move, were aligned with Fed Chair Jerome Powell and the others besides Miran this time. Miran was selected by Trump back in August to fill the seat that was vacated by former Governor Adriana Kugler after she suddenly announced her resignation without stating a reason for doing so. He has said that he will take an unpaid leave of absence as chair of the White House’s Council of Economic Advisors rather than fully resign from the position. Miran’s place on the board, which will last until Jan. 31, 2026 when Kugler’s term was due to end, has been viewed by critics as a threat from Trump to the Fed’s independence, as the president has nominated three of the seven members.
